What the numbers mean for you

Of the 325 car tests taken at Fort William between April 2025 and March 2026, 214 ended in a pass. That is better than the 50% average across every centre in the country, by 15.8 percentage points.

Against the year before, the pass rate rose 3.1 points from 62.7%.

A pass rate is not a difficulty score. It measures who passed, not how hard the routes are. Centres serving mostly well-prepared candidates score higher, and a quiet rural centre with few tests can swing several points on a handful of results. Use it to compare options, not to predict your own result.

Getting an earlier test at Fort William

Waiting times are set locally, and the national picture (a 20.2 week average) hides a big spread between centres. Whatever the queue at Fort William, the route to a sooner date is the same: hold a booking, then watch for cancellations.

  1. Book whatever slot Fort William has, even months out. You cannot swap to a cancellation without an existing booking.
  2. Watch the free GOV.UK change service, especially just after 6am when the booking system reopens.
  3. Take an earlier slot when one appears, remembering car tests allow only 2 changes.

Is Fort William a hard test centre?

Its pass rate is 15.8 points above the national average, so on the DVSA numbers it is an easier centre than most. Pass rates reflect who takes tests there as much as the routes themselves, so treat it as a guide rather than a promise.

How do I get an earlier test at Fort William?

Book any available slot at Fort William first, then watch the free change service on GOV.UK for cancellations. Slots freed by other candidates reappear in the booking calendar within minutes and go quickly, so check early mornings around 6am. Car tests allow only 2 changes, so save them for a date you would genuinely keep.
